5. Conclusion

As we have seen in this article, localized airflow protection can deliver greater performance than global protection. The geometry of the devices, and in particular the guides, as well as the use of air returns and air flows of different densities, can ensure a robust curtain, even in the event of break-ins. The protection is economical to install (no workshop modifications as extensive as for the installation of an entire cleanroom, adaptation to pre-existing lines, modularity to suit changes in production) and to use (lower energy consumption, less frequent filter replacement).

Localized airflow protection thus has the qualities to contribute to the factory of the future.
